Obituary Donald Eugene Hockett, son of Dale and Mabel (Rummel) Hockett, was born February 7, 1928 on his parents' farm in Rawlins County, KS. He lived his first 21 years on the farm helping his parents until he met his wife, the 'Country School Teacher', Odessa Nadine Bayer. They married August 7, 1949. This was just the start of their 65 years together. After leaving the farm he spent many years over the roads, trucking. His love for automobiles led him to hauling cars and then on to many other cross-country, coast-to-coast opportunities. After all those years he decided it was time to quit and go back to farming where he was raised. He felt it was the best place to raise a family and that it was far better to have all the family together. While he was back on the farm, milking cows, he decided that something important was missing so he took his wife Nadine and two children; Ricky Lynn and Geneva Lea to a little country church where they found and accepted Jesus Christ as their personal savior on April 4, 1966. To this day they always tell each other 'Happy Birthday' on that date. Don's faith was always very strong and solid, his heart full of love to serve the Lord. He was involved with the church where ever he was and also The Full Gospel Business Men's Fellowship International (FGBMFI) in both Kansas and Colorado. In 1978 he left the farm and moved to Colorado Springs, where he was employed with Penrose Hospital for several years before retiring and working for the car auction in Fountain, CO. One of his latest and greatest moments was when he discovered he was of Jewish Heritage, more specifically of the Tribe of Levi.
